Relative Risk

Relative risk (RR) is a statistical measure commonly used in epidemiology to compare the likelihood of a particular event occurring between two groups. This metric is important for evaluating the relationship between exposure to a specific risk factor and the probability of a particular outcome. It plays a crucial role in medical research, public health studies, and risk assessment. Deindividuation

Deindividuation is a form of social influence on an individual’s behavior such that the individual engages in unusual or non-normal behavior while in a group setting. Why? Because in these group settings, the individual no longer sees themselves as an individual anymore, disinhibiting their behavior and personal restraint.

Objective Risk in Trust Decisions Under Varying Social Distance: An Exploratory fMRI Study.

Ying Chen1, Chengru Zhao1, Xia Wu2

  • 1Department of Psychology, Tianjin University of Technology and Education, Tianjin 300222, China.

Behavioral Sciences (Basel, Switzerland)
|May 27, 2026
PubMed
Summary

Objective risk significantly impacted trust decisions and brain activity more than social distance. This study explored how people make trust decisions under varying risk levels and social contexts.

Area of Science:

  • Neuroscience
  • Cognitive Science
  • Decision Science

Background:

  • Trust decisions integrate social evaluation and uncertainty processing.
  • Existing trust game paradigms often fail to fully separate social trust from general risk/value computations.
  • Understanding the neural basis of trust under varying objective risk and social contexts is crucial.

Purpose of the Study:

  • To investigate the neural correlates of trust decisions influenced by objective risk and social distance.
  • To dissociate the effects of objective risk from social distance on trust behavior and brain activation.
  • To explore how the brain processes trust in a controlled experimental setting.

Main Methods:

  • Employed a 2x2 trust game paradigm within a whole-brain functional Magnetic Resonance Imaging (fMRI) study.
  • Recruited 23 adult participants, with 20 included in fMRI analyses after motion artifact exclusion.
  • Analyzed behavioral data for trust rates and fMRI data for brain activation patterns.

Main Results:

  • Behaviorally, higher objective risk led to significantly lower trust rates.
  • Trust decisions, compared to distrust, showed increased activation in prefrontal and visual areas, and decreased activation in the insula.
  • Objective risk modulated neural activity in temporal, supramarginal, and precentral regions, while social distance did not yield significant neural effects.

Conclusions:

  • Objective risk appears to be a more dominant factor than social distance in driving behavioral and neural variations in trust decisions within this specific low-context paradigm.
  • The findings suggest distinct neural pathways for processing objective risk versus social factors in trust.
  • Further research with larger sample sizes and refined tasks is needed to fully elucidate the neural underpinnings of social trust.
